GOSSIP GIRL. A MASTERPIECE.



The lives of several rich students at Constance Billard Prep School, a top-tier exclusive high school in Manhattan's Upper East Side, are chronicled in this drama television series. The pupils at this high school rapidly learn that they can't keep any secrets from Gossip Girl, a blogger who lurks among the students. Who could Gossip Girl be, is the burning question on every student's mind. Who is eavesdropping on their classmates' personal lives?

Blair Waldorf, Chuck Bass, Nate Archibald, Serena van der Woodsen, and Dan Humphrey are the five kids who have everyone's attention. Each and every one of them play a significant role in the elite high school. Blair, is the queen B, Serena, the IT girl, Dan, the outsider, Chuck and Nate, the playboys.

Another reason this show is the finest is that it depicts the reality of how social media can control and dominate people's lives. Everyone is addicted to the Gossip Girl website. Even if it destroys relationships, people will continue to read it.


The network decided to take advantage of this in a stroke of marketing genius, launching the now-iconic OMFG campaign for the show's return in spring 2008, following the end of the writer's strike.
